Rum & Rhythm Overview
In 2025, the carnival season is bursting with new energy, and the Rum and Rhythm Riddim fits right in. Its lively soca base brings a fresh sound to the year, making it a favorite for party crowds and masqueraders who can’t stop moving when it plays. The influence behind this riddim comes from the producers, Caridigital Productions and Shac Music. Caridigital Productions, known for its crisp, modern soca sound, has worked on several popular releases in the past decade. Shac Music is also no stranger to the scene, with a reputation for bringing big, festival-ready tracks to life. Together, they shape a bright, anthemic sound that stands out. Each artist on the riddim brings something unique. 6ixty1Gad delivers “Full Attention,” a track that showcases his energetic style. He is known for his stage presence and catchy hooks, which have helped him build a strong following across the Caribbean. Faith Callender’s “My Guide” adds a soulful touch. Faith is celebrated in Barbados for her powerful vocals and has earned recognition with songs like “Lift My Head” and her 2020 win at the Barbados Music Awards. Maloneyy’s “No One Else” keeps the pace going with smooth melodies, while Shac, who also co-produced the riddim, steps in front of the mic for “Lost In Paradise.” Shac’s dual role as artist and producer adds a special touch, connecting the music from the studio to the stage.
Rum & Rhythm Tracklist:
- 6ixty1Gad – Full Attention
- Faith Callender – My Guide
- Maloneyy – No One Else
- Shac – Lost In Paradise
